Itinerary
Tour Itinerary
The largest church in Austria is Linz Mariendom,... 30 minutes
The largest church in Austria is Linz Mariendom, the church also called Neuer Dom is an indispensable part of Linz's cityscape, an architectural masterpiece
The Linz Castle is located on a hill... 30 minutes
The Linz Castle is located on a hill above the old town of Linz directly on the Danube and offers a beautiful view of the old town of Linz.
The Sankt Florian Abbey is one of the... 30 minutes
The Sankt Florian Abbey is one of the largest and best-known Baroque monasteries in Austria. The magnificent, almost intact preserved baroque buildings with the abbey basilica are simply worth seeing!
The Pöstlingberg is the landmark of Linz, Austria 30 minutes
The Pöstlingberg is the landmark of Linz, Austria. It is a popular destination with an observation deck overlooking the whole city of Linz and the Alpine foothills and the Alps in good visibility.
